Xbox series S (But that doesn't really matter for this bug in particular)
Monte Carlo Bayonet Catalyst being active/inactive at incorrect times due to picking up certain throwables (eg; exotic engrams from expeditions) or activating certain abilities (eg; activating renegade abilities or swapping to a different weapon during super)
Step one
Get Markov chain x5, activate Bayonet
Step two
Activate super; activate renegade abilities; pick up the wrong throwable (such as expedition exotic engrams; weirdly enough it's only certain throwables/carriables, not all, The exotic engram is just the most convenient one I could find for an example)
Step 3
Swap weapons during super. Picking up an engram or activating renegade abilities doesn't require a step 3, because it just happens in step two
EXPECTED RESULT: Bayonet remembering its properties; such as overwriting melee when it's supposed to, or not overriding when it's not supposed to
ACTUAL RESULT: Bayonet not remembering it's melee overriding property through certain actions/transferring the melee override to other weapons
